PRESS DIGEST - Indian Business News - June 19

MUMBAI, June 19 (Reuters) - Indian newspapers carried the following stories in their print or Web editions on Thursday. Reuters has not verified these stories and does not vouch for their accuracy.

DAILY NEWS & ANALYSIS (www.dnaindia.com)

* National carrier Air India [AI.UL] and Boeing <BA.N> are seeking a majority stake in the proposed maintenance, repair and overhaul venture in Nagpur.

* IVR Prime Urban Developers Ltd <IVR.BO> will invest up to 7.5 billion rupees to set up holiday resorts and conference centres across India to cash-in on the fast-growing meetings, incentives, conventions and events market here.

ECONOMIC TIMES (www.economictimes.com)

* Private equity fund, NYLIM Jacob Ballas India Fund, is close to picking up 21.5 percent in Devyani International, a Ravi Jaipuria-promoted company that owns Pizza Hut, KFC and Costa Coffee in India, for more than 3 billion rupees.

FINANCIAL EXPRESS (www.financialexpresss.com)

* State-run Bharat Heavy Electricals <BHEL.BO> has outbid Alstom Projects India <ABBP.BO> to become the lowest bidder for the engineering, procurement and construction contract of the 740 megawatt, gas-based power project in Tripura.

* Zee Entertainment Studios, the motion picture division of Zee Entertainment Enterprises <ZEE.BO>, may list its two divisions, Zee Motion Pictures and Zee Limelight, on the London Stock Exchange's Alternative Investment Market.

TIMES OF INDIA (www.timesofindia.com)

* State-owned refinery Hindustan Petroleum Corp <HPCL.BO> is in talks with Coal India and the West Bengal government for the takeover of ailing Dankuni Coal Complex and Greater Calcutta Gas Supply Corp.

($1= 42.89 rupees)
